Fourth year - Mastering Marketing & Communication strategies
Strategic approaches in the communication and marketing sectors (240 ECTS)
Strategy and managerial skills are at the heart of fourth year communication training. Take charge of the global dimension of a communications department by controlling budgets, leading communications teams and defining a 360° or specialized BtoB or BtoC strategy. The prelude to a hyper-specialized fifth year, it enables students to project themselves into their professional future, thanks in particular to a six-month immersion internship.

Work-study courses
A work-study program is available from fourth year for the Digital Marketing & Business specialization in Paris. Students follow specific courses to acquire the skills needed to manage digital transformations.

What do I learn in my fourth year at EFAP?
The fourth year at EFAP marks a step up in expertise. Students delve deeper into communications and brand strategies, corporate and internal communications, as well as event management and crisis management. Emphasis is also placed on creativity, with modules such as the Talk Show Factory, creative advertising and graphic design, and on digital & AI (digital marketing, prompt engineering, the ethical challenges of AI). This year prepares students for more strategic responsibilities and project management roles.
What core courses are taken in fourth year at EFAP?
The fourth year courses cover several areas:
- Strategy & communications: communications strategy, event management, media relations, brand content, crisis, corporate and internal communications.
- Creativity: Talk Show Factory, creative advertising, graphic design.
- Digital & AI: digital marketing & AI, marketing management, AI & prompt engineering, ethical and societal issues related to AI.
- Management & projects: project management, budget management.
These courses combine strategy, innovation and technology to prepare students for positions of responsibility.
Is there a compulsory internship in fourth year?
Yes, the fourth year includes a compulsory six-month internship, a real springboard to junior-level responsibilities. Students can also choose to spend a semester studying abroad at a partner university. This professional or academic immersion reinforces the expertise acquired and prepares students effectively for the final year of specialization.

Throughout the year, students take part in immersive educational events and challenges: Masterclasses with professionals, Creative Battle, Crisis Sprint (an intensive crisis communication exercise) and the AI Lab Day dedicated to the challenges and uses of artificial intelligence. These practical projects complement the theoretical courses and enable students to test their skills in real-life conditions, in direct line with market expectations.
